Whose Skeleton is Stronger, Wolverine or Superman?

Wolverine and Superman are two of the most iconic superheroes in comic book history. Both possess superhuman strength and durability, but who has the stronger skeleton?

Wolverine's skeleton is coated in adamantium, an indestructible metal. This gives him immense resistance to physical damage, including bullets and blades. Superman's skeleton, on the other hand, is naturally dense and durable. It is also infused with solar energy, which further strengthens it.

In terms of raw strength, Superman's skeleton is undoubtedly stronger. He can lift and throw objects that weigh thousands of tons. Wolverine's skeleton, while incredibly durable, is not as strong as Superman's.

However, there is one area where Wolverine's skeleton excels: regeneration. Wolverine's mutant healing factor allows him to regenerate from almost any injury, including bone fractures. Superman's skeleton does not possess this ability.

Ultimately, the question of who has the stronger skeleton depends on the specific criteria being considered. In terms of raw strength, Superman has the advantage. However, Wolverine's skeleton is more durable and can regenerate from damage.
